コンテンツにスキップ

トラブルシューティング

OpenAI Agents SDK は次の サーバー 環境でサポートされています:

  • Node.js 22 以降
  • Deno 2.35 以降
  • Bun 1.2.5 以降
  • Cloudflare Workers: Agents SDK は Cloudflare Workers でも使用できますが、現時点ではいくつかの制限があります
    • 現在、SDK には nodejs_compat を有効にする必要があります
    • トレースはリクエストの最後に手動でフラッシュする必要があります。トレーシングを参照してください
    • Cloudflare Workers における AsyncLocalStorage のサポートが限定的なため、一部のトレースが正確でない可能性があります
  • ブラウザ:
    • ブラウザでは現在トレーシングはサポートされていません
  • v8 isolates:
    • 適切なブラウザ用ポリフィルを備えたバンドラを使えば v8 isolates 向けに SDK をバンドルできるはずですが、トレーシングは機能しません
    • v8 isolates は十分にテストされていません

SDK で問題が発生している場合、デバッグログを有効にすると詳細を確認できます。

デバッグログは、環境変数 DEBUGopenai-agents:* に設定すると有効になります。

Terminal window
DEBUG=openai-agents:*

または、SDK の特定部分に範囲を絞ってデバッグできます:

  • openai-agents:core — SDK のメイン実行ロジック用に
  • openai-agents:openai — OpenAI API 呼び出し用に
  • openai-agents:realtime — リアルタイムエージェント コンポーネント用に